Chota Kandali Population - Nagaon, Assam

Chota Kandali is a medium size village located in Nagaon Circle of Nagaon district, Assam with total 73 families residing. The Chota Kandali village has population of 373 of which 192 are males while 181 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Chota Kandali village population of children with age 0-6 is 69 which makes up 18.50 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chota Kandali village is 943 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Chota Kandali as per census is 1226, higher than Assam average of 962.

Chota Kandali village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Chota Kandali village was 61.51 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Chota Kandali Male literacy stands at 69.57 % while female literacy rate was 52.45 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 2.14 % of total population in Chota Kandali village. The village Chota Kandali curr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Chota Kandali village out of total population, 184 were engaged in work activities. 52.17 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 47.83 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 184 workers engaged in Main Work, 78 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 15 were Agricultural labourer.
